Laman Utama / Pusat Blog / DocuSign API: Membenamkan "Pandangan Pengirim" (Pandangan Penandaan) dalam Aplikasi Anda

DocuSign API: Membenamkan "Pandangan Pengirim" (Pandangan Penandaan) dalam Aplikasi Anda

Shunfang
2026-03-07
3min
Twitter Facebook Linkedin

Membenamkan Paparan Penghantar DocuSign ke dalam Aplikasi Anda: Panduan Praktikal

Dalam landskap protokol digital yang sentiasa berkembang, mengintegrasikan platform tandatangan elektronik seperti DocuSign ke dalam aplikasi tersuai telah menjadi strategi penting untuk perniagaan yang bertujuan untuk menyelaraskan aliran kerja. Paparan Penghantar, yang sering dirujuk sebagai Paparan Penandaan, ialah komponen penting dalam API eSignature DocuSign. Ia membolehkan penghantar berinteraksi secara interaktif dengan dokumen secara langsung dalam antara muka terbenam untuk menandakan medan seperti blok tandatangan, cap tarikh dan input teks. Fungsi ini meningkatkan pengalaman pengguna dengan membolehkan penyediaan dokumen masa nyata tanpa meninggalkan aplikasi anda, mengurangkan geseran dalam proses pengurusan kontrak. Dari sudut pandangan komersial, membenamkan paparan ini boleh meningkatkan kecekapan operasi, terutamanya untuk penyedia SaaS dan pembangun perisian perusahaan yang mengendalikan perjanjian volum tinggi.

image


Membandingkan platform tandatangan elektronik dengan DocuSign atau Adobe Sign?

eSignGlobal menawarkan penyelesaian tandatangan elektronik yang lebih fleksibel dan kos efektif dengan pematuhan global, harga yang telus dan proses penerimaan yang lebih pantas.

👉 Mulakan percubaan percuma


Memahami Paparan Penghantar dalam Ekosistem API DocuSign

API eSignature DocuSign direka bentuk untuk pembangun mengautomasikan dan membenamkan pengalaman tandatangan ke dalam aplikasi. Paparan Penghantar secara khusus merujuk kepada antara muka pengarangan di mana pengguna menyediakan sampul surat (istilah DocuSign untuk pakej dokumen) dengan meletakkan tag pada PDF atau fail lain. Paparan ini menyokong fungsi seret dan lepas untuk medan seperti tandatangan, huruf awal, kotak semak dan butang radio, memastikan pematuhan dengan piawaian undang-undang seperti ESIGN dan UETA A.S.

Dari sudut pandangan komersial, integrasi ini menarik minat industri seperti hartanah, kewangan dan sumber manusia, yang memerlukan proses dokumen yang boleh disesuaikan. Perniagaan yang menggunakan teknologi ini boleh mengurangkan ralat manual dan mempercepatkan kitaran transaksi, yang berpotensi meningkatkan kadar penukaran sebanyak 20-30% berdasarkan penanda aras industri. Walau bagaimanapun, pelaksanaan memerlukan pertimbangan yang teliti terhadap kuota API dan pengesahan untuk mengelakkan kos yang tidak dijangka.

Panduan Langkah demi Langkah untuk Membenamkan Paparan Penghantar Menggunakan API DocuSign

Prasyarat Integrasi

Sebelum mendalami kod, pastikan anda mempunyai akaun pembangun DocuSign. Daftar untuk Kotak Pasir Pembangun percuma di developer.docusign.com, yang menyediakan kelayakan kotak pasir dan akses API tanpa kos pengeluaran. Anda memerlukan:

  • Token API: Dijana melalui OAuth 2.0 untuk pengesahan selamat.
  • Definisi Sampul Surat: Struktur JSON yang menggariskan dokumen dan peranan penerima.
  • Pemilihan SDK: DocuSign menawarkan SDK dalam bahasa seperti Java, .NET, PHP dan Node.js untuk memudahkan panggilan.

Titik Akhir API Utama: Gunakan kaedah Envelopes:create di bawah eSignature REST API v2.1 untuk memulakan sampul surat, kemudian gunakan titik akhir Views:requestSender untuk menjana URL Paparan Penghantar.

Melaksanakan Proses Pembenaman

  1. Sahkan dan Cipta Sampul Surat: Mulakan dengan mengesahkan aplikasi anda menggunakan JWT DocuSign atau aliran pemberian kod kebenaran. Selepas pengesahan, muat naik dokumen anda melalui API.

    Contoh Node.js menggunakan SDK DocuSign:

    const dsApi = new docusign.EsSignatureApi();
    const envelopeDefinition = new docusign.EnvelopeDefinition();
    envelopeDefinition.emailSubject = 'Sila tandatangani dokumen ini';
    const document = new docusign.Document({
      documentBase64: Buffer.from(fs.readFileSync('path/to/document.pdf')).toString('base64'),
      name: 'Dokumen Contoh',
      fileExtension: 'pdf',
      documentId: '1'
    });
    envelopeDefinition.documents = [document];
    const results = yield dsApi.createEnvelope(accountId, { envelopeDefinition });
    const envelopeId = results.envelopeId;
    

    Ini mencipta draf sampul surat yang sedia untuk ditandakan.

  2. Jana URL Paparan Penghantar: Panggil paparan requestSender untuk mendapatkan URL yang boleh dibenamkan. URL ini membuka Paparan Penandaan dalam iframe atau tetingkap baharu dalam aplikasi anda.

    const viewRequest = new docusign.ViewRequest({
      returnUrl: 'https://yourapp.com/callback',  // Halakan semula selepas penandaan
      userName: 'Nama Penghantar',
      email: 'sender@example.com'
    });
    const senderView = yield dsApi.createSenderView(accountId, envelopeId, { viewRequest });
    const senderUrl = senderView.url;  // Benamkan URL ini dalam aplikasi anda
    

    Parameter returnUrl memastikan kawalan kembali ke aplikasi anda selepas penandaan, di mana anda boleh mencetuskan penghantaran.

  3. Benamkan dalam Aplikasi Anda: Untuk integrasi yang lancar, gunakan iframe untuk memuatkan senderUrl. Pastikan UI aplikasi anda membungkusnya dengan cara yang responsif.

    Contoh HTML:

    <iframe src="{senderUrl}" width="100%" height="800px" frameborder="0"></iframe>
    

    Urus CORS dengan mengkonfigurasi asal yang dibenarkan DocuSign dalam tetapan akaun anda. Untuk aplikasi mudah alih, pertimbangkan pautan dalam atau pembenaman WebView.

  4. Urus Operasi Selepas Penandaan: Selepas penandaan, panggilan balik API membolehkan anda memuktamadkan sampul surat menggunakan Envelopes:update. Tambah penerima dan hantar melalui Envelopes:send.

    Pantau penggunaan melalui papan pemuka API untuk kekal dalam kuota—pelan Permulaan dihadkan kepada kira-kira 40 sampul surat sebulan, dengan keperluan untuk meningkatkan skala untuk persekitaran pengeluaran.

Amalan Terbaik dan Cabaran Potensi

  • Keselamatan: Sentiasa gunakan HTTPS dan sahkan token untuk mengelakkan akses tanpa kebenaran. Laksanakan kawalan akses berasaskan peranan untuk aplikasi berbilang pengguna.
  • Penyesuaian: Paparan Penandaan menyokong sauh (penempatan automatik berasaskan teks) dan templat untuk mempramuatkan medan, mengurangkan usaha pengguna.
  • Pengendalian Ralat: Isu biasa termasuk dokumen yang tidak sah (cth., format bukan PDF) atau melebihi kuota. Gunakan blok try-catch dan kod ralat DocuSign (cth., 400 untuk permintaan yang tidak sah).
  • Kebolehskalaan: Untuk aplikasi volum tinggi, pilih pelan API premium (AS$5,760 setahun), yang menyokong penghantaran pukal.

Perniagaan yang membenamkan paparan ini melaporkan kelajuan penerimaan yang lebih pantas—mengurangkan masa persediaan sehingga 50%—tetapi mesti menimbang kos API berbanding faedah. Di Asia Pasifik (APAC), di mana kependaman boleh menjejaskan pengalaman pengguna, menguji prestasi rentas sempadan adalah penting.

image

Gambaran Keseluruhan Rangkaian Produk DocuSign yang Lebih Luas

Platform eSignature DocuSign meluas di luar API untuk merangkumi Pengurusan Perjanjian Pintar (IAM) dan alat Pengurusan Kitaran Hayat Kontrak (CLM). IAM mengautomasikan proses perjanjian menggunakan cerapan yang dipacu AI, manakala CLM mengendalikan aliran kerja kontrak hujung ke hujung, daripada draf hingga pembaharuan. Harga bermula pada AS$10 sebulan untuk pelan individu, meningkat kepada pakej peringkat perusahaan tersuai dengan ciri seperti SSO dan analitik lanjutan. Alat ini disepadukan dengan lancar dengan API, menjadikan pembenaman Paparan Penghantar sebagai lanjutan semula jadi kepada transformasi digital yang komprehensif.

Landskap Persaingan: Perbandingan Platform Tandatangan Elektronik

Dalam pasaran tandatangan elektronik yang kompetitif, DocuSign menerajui dengan keupayaan API yang mantap, tetapi alternatif seperti Adobe Sign, eSignGlobal dan HelloSign menawarkan kelebihan yang berbeza dari segi harga, pematuhan dan tumpuan serantau. Berikut ialah perbandingan neutral berdasarkan faktor utama seperti integrasi API, harga dan sokongan pematuhan.

Ciri/Platform DocuSign Adobe Sign eSignGlobal HelloSign (Dropbox Sign)
Pembenaman API (cth., Paparan Penghantar/Penandaan) Lanjutan: SDK penuh, penghantaran pukal, Webhooks; kuota bermula pada 40 sampul surat sebulan Teguh: REST API dengan tandatangan terbenam; integrasi dengan ekosistem Adobe Termasuk dalam pelan Pro: API untuk penghantaran pukal, paparan terbenam; pengguna tanpa had Asas: API pembenaman mudah; tumpuan pada kemudahan penggunaan tetapi penandaan lanjutan terhad
Harga (peringkat kemasukan tahunan) $120 (Peribadi, 1 pengguna, 5 sampul surat sebulan) $239.88 (Individu, sampul surat tanpa had) $299 (Penting, pengguna tanpa had, 100 sampul surat) $180 (Penting, 3 pengguna, sampul surat tanpa had)
Tumpuan Pematuhan Global: ESIGN, eIDAS, GDPR; teguh di A.S./EU Global: ESIGN, eIDAS; keselamatan perusahaan Adobe Pematuhan 100+ negara; mendalam di APAC dengan iAM Smart/Singpass Terutamanya A.S./EU: ESIGN, UETA; asas antarabangsa
Had Pengguna Pelesenan setiap tempat duduk Tanpa had pada peringkat yang lebih tinggi Pengguna tanpa had, tiada yuran tempat duduk Sehingga 50 pengguna dalam Pro
Ciri Tambahan (cth., SMS/IDV) Meteran: SMS, IDV tambahan Dibundel dengan pelan Acrobat Termasuk: SMS/WhatsApp; integrasi ID serantau SMS asas; tiada IDV lanjutan
Sesuai untuk Automasi perusahaan, penggunaan API volum tinggi Aliran kerja intensif kreatif/dokumen APAC/pematuhan serantau, pasukan sensitif kos PKS yang mencari kesederhanaan

Jadual ini menyerlahkan pertukaran: DocuSign cemerlang dalam kedalaman tetapi pada kos setiap pengguna yang lebih tinggi, manakala platform lain mengutamakan fleksibiliti.

Meneroka Adobe Sign sebagai Alternatif

Adobe Sign, sebahagian daripada Adobe Document Cloud, menekankan integrasi yang lancar dengan alat PDF dan suite kreatif. APInya menyokong paparan pengarangan terbenam yang serupa dengan Paparan Penghantar DocuSign, membenarkan pembangun menandakan dokumen melalui panggilan REST. Harga adalah kompetitif untuk sampul surat tanpa had, bermula pada kira-kira AS$20 sebulan setiap pengguna, dengan ciri perusahaan yang teguh seperti tandatangan mudah alih dan analitik. Perusahaan dengan jabatan reka bentuk atau undang-undang sering memilihnya kerana keserasian asli Adobe Acrobat, walaupun kuota API mungkin terhad untuk aplikasi volum yang sangat tinggi.

image

Menyerlahkan eSignGlobal: Pesaing Serantau

eSignGlobal meletakkan dirinya sebagai penyedia tandatangan elektronik yang mematuhi global, menyokong tandatangan elektronik di lebih 100 negara dan wilayah arus perdana. Ia mempunyai kelebihan tertentu di Asia Pasifik (APAC), di mana peraturan tandatangan elektronik adalah berpecah-belah, berstandard tinggi dan dikawal ketat. Tidak seperti piawaian berasaskan rangka kerja A.S. (ESIGN) dan EU (eIDAS), yang bergantung pada garis panduan yang luas, piawaian APAC menekankan pendekatan "integrasi ekosistem". Ini memerlukan integrasi perkakasan dan peringkat API yang mendalam dengan identiti digital kerajaan kepada perniagaan (G2B), dengan ambang teknologi yang jauh melebihi pengesahan e-mel atau kaedah pengisytiharan kendiri yang biasa di Barat.

eSignGlobal menangani cabaran ini melalui integrasi asli seperti iAM Smart Hong Kong dan Singpass Singapura, memastikan kesahan undang-undang tanpa tambahan tambahan. Harganya sedikit lebih rendah daripada pesaing; pelan Penting pada AS$16.6 sebulan (bersamaan dengan AS$199 setahun, walaupun fungsi penuh disenaraikan pada AS$299) membenarkan sehingga 100 dokumen e-tandatangan, tempat duduk pengguna tanpa had dan pengesahan kod akses—semuanya berdasarkan asas pematuhan. Ini menjadikannya sangat kos efektif untuk pasukan yang berkembang di APAC, di mana kependaman rentas sempadan dan kebimbangan pemastautinan data menghantui gergasi global.

esignglobal HK


Mencari alternatif yang lebih pintar daripada DocuSign?

eSignGlobal menawarkan penyelesaian tandatangan elektronik yang lebih fleksibel dan kos efektif dengan pematuhan global, harga yang telus dan proses penerimaan yang lebih pantas.

👉 Mulakan percubaan percuma


HelloSign dan Pemain Lain

HelloSign, kini sebahagian daripada Dropbox, menawarkan API mesra pengguna untuk membenamkan antara muka penandaan mudah, sesuai untuk PKS. Kekuatannya terletak pada sampul surat tanpa had pada harga permulaan yang lebih rendah (AS$15/pengguna sebulan), tetapi ia kekurangan logik bersyarat lanjutan DocuSign. Pesaing lain seperti PandaDoc lebih menumpukan pada cadangan daripada e-tandatangan tulen, manakala SignNow menawarkan akses API yang berpatutan untuk pematuhan EU.

Pemikiran Akhir tentang Memilih Platform yang Betul

Bagi perniagaan yang mengutamakan pembenaman yang dipacu API seperti Paparan Penghantar, DocuSign kekal sebagai pilihan yang boleh dipercayai kerana kematangan dan ekosistemnya. Walau bagaimanapun, apabila keperluan serantau berkembang—terutamanya dalam pasaran yang dikawal—alternatif muncul. Untuk pematuhan khusus serantau, eSignGlobal muncul sebagai alternatif DocuSign yang neutral dan berdaya maju, menawarkan fungsi yang seimbang dan harga yang kompetitif. Nilaikan berdasarkan kapasiti, geografi dan kedalaman integrasi anda untuk mengoptimumkan ROI.

avatar
Shunfang
Ketua Pengurusan Produk di eSignGlobal, seorang pemimpin berpengalaman dengan pengalaman antarabangsa yang luas dalam industri tandatangan elektronik. Ikuti LinkedIn saya